"The Towering Inferno" - actually started as two different films: "The Tower" and "The Glass Inferno". They merged both productions, getting both budgets and both sets of stars. ... @JoseMorales-lw5nt 3 жыл бұрын
Fun fact: Kubrick was told to push back the release date for DR. STRANGELOVE so audiences could take in FAIL-SAFE first. Knowing 2 films were using the same source material, studio heads compromised. Reasoning that audiences would be better off seeing the dramatic version first, FAIL-SAFE got the 1963 release they hoped for. While STRANGELOVE was pushed back to a 1964 release, there was an unintended impact to Kubrick's masterpiece. As the agreement was set for the 2 films, John F. Kennedy was senselessly killed in late November, 1963. Consequently, one scene mentioning the city of Dallas was redubbed to sound like LAS VEGAS. While the original pie fight finale was cut out for the now infamous bombing finale. In case your wondering, Kubrick's original ending saw the President being taken out by massive pie hits. My Blue Heaven and Goodfellas are based on the same book. Nicholas Pellegi was the author of "Wiseguy" and interviewed Henry Hill for the book. He was married to Nora Ephron who wrote the screenplay for My Blue Heaven. Even funnier, My Blue Heaven came out a month before Goodfellas making it "the original."
